Nestled in the vibrant heart of North London, Near and Far Camden is a nightclub that embodies the eclectic and dynamic spirit of the city’s nightlife. Originally conceived as part of the Near and Far brand, known for its quirky, travel-inspired theme, this venue opened its doors to the Camden crowd with the promise of an immersive experience that marries imaginative design with a diverse musical lineup. The club has quickly become a staple in Camden’s nightlife scene, celebrated for its unique atmosphere that blends vintage décor with a modern sound system.

Near and Far Camden occupies a distinctive location within the iconic Camden Lock Market area, drawing both tourists and locals alike. Its interior is a visual journey around the world, with each corner offering a different thematic experience, from retro Palm Springs vibes to a New York rooftop feel, all underpinned by an ethos of sustainability and community engagement. Since its inception, Near and Far Camden has built a reputation for being a cultural hub where music and creative expression thrive.

The venue’s significance lies not only in its musical offerings but also in its role as a social space that fosters inclusivity and diversity. Known for hosting a wide array of events, from themed nights to DJ sets, the club has solidified its place as a go-to destination for those seeking an alternative yet vibrant night out. Over time, while the core essence of Near and Far has remained intact, the venue has adapted to the ever-evolving landscape of London's nightlife, incorporating new technologies and sound systems to enhance the auditory experience without losing its distinctive charm.

Notable artists who have graced the decks at Near and Far Camden include both international sensations and local talents. Among them are the likes of electronic music producer and DJ Auntie Flo, whose world-influenced beats have captivated audiences worldwide, and London-based DJ and producer Emerald, known for her eclectic mixes and energetic sets. The venue has also welcomed the likes of Horse Meat Disco, celebrated for their disco-infused dance tracks, and local favorite DJ Jossy Mitsu, whose bass-driven sound has become a staple in the UK underground scene.

These artists, among others, have contributed to the venue's burgeoning reputation as a place where the boundaries of music are continually pushed, and where the pulse of Camden’s nightlife beats strongest.
